This propeller shaft set from O.S. Engine is made for OMA-28 motor interfaces and M3 shaft fittings. It serves as the motor shaft and propeller coupling piece that connects a motor output to a propeller or driveline element on scale RC aircraft and related models.
The part secures the propeller while preserving axial alignment. When replacing the shaft or adjusting prop mounting, pay attention to thread engagement and concentric fit; the M3 thread size is the reference to confirm before fitment.
Installation notes: confirm the motor and prop hub match OMA-28 and M3 dimensions, start the thread by hand to prevent cross-threading, and tighten progressively following good fastening practice. After installation, check propeller runout to ensure balance and smooth driveline performance before flight or operation.
Maintenance and tuning: inspect the shaft for wear, corrosion, or deformation prior to reuse, and keep mating surfaces clean. If vibration or imbalance occurs after replacement, re-check shaft seating and prop seating to restore proper driveline alignment.
